The Benefits of Mentoring Youth through BBBSLI
Big Brothers Big Sisters of America reports that after 18 months of spending time with their Bigs, Littles were influenced in many different ways.
The study found that Littles were:
- 46 percent less likely to begin using illegal drugs
- 27 percent less likely to begin drinking alcohol
- 52 percent less likely to skip school
- 37 percent less likely to skip a class
- 33 percent less likely to hit someone
1) Educational Achievement
Bigs often have a huge impact on the educational achievements of the Littles that they mentor. Mentoring youth can even change the whole course of their school experience.
BBBSLI’s Littles typically have:
- Fewer unexcused absences
- A better overall attitude towards school
- A greater chance of enrolling in higher education
2) Social and Emotional Development
Bigs also play a major role in influencing the social and emotional development of their mentees.
Through sharing life experiences and offering advice, mentoring youth through BBBSLI promotes positive social attitudes and relationships. Many of the mentees also develop better communication skills, because they have the opportunity to participate in more social situations.
Big Brothers and Big Sisters are also inspiring forces in the lives of Littles. Through the actions and advice of Bigs, young people often learn many important life lessons.
3) Building Career Foundations
For many Long Island youth who are facing adversity, building a successful career may seem like an impossibility. Mentoring youth prepares mentees for life after high school by improving workplace skills, such as:
- Helping to set career goals
- Introducing young people to resources and organizations they may not be familiar with
- Using personal contacts to help young people network with industry professionals, find internships and locate possible jobs
- Enhancing job skills, like finding, interviewing and retaining a job.
